In 2002, pop icon Britney Spears demonstrated remarkable resilience on the set of her 'Overprotected' music video. Director Chris Applebaum shared how Spears received devastating news of her breakup with Justin Timberlake via text message after a grueling 20-hour filming session.
Despite the emotional blow, Spears, then 21, found inspiration in a simple snack—animal crackers. Applebaum recounted how he encouraged Spears to channel her feelings into a performance so powerful it would showcase Timberlake's loss. Spears embraced the idea, leading to a memorable scene during the song's bridge.
This emotional resurgence resulted in a performance that deeply moved the video's choreographer, Brian Friedman, earning him an MTV Video Music Award nomination for Best Choreography. The incident highlighted Spears' strength and artistic dedication amidst personal turmoil.
